1. Seating and Upholstery
Seats bear the brunt of day-to-day use. Depending upon the model year (from second-generation classics to the most recent 5th-generation Ram 1500s), interior choices range from standard vinyl to premium perforated leather.
- Seat Covers: A cost-efficient way to secure original upholstery from mud, pets, and tools. Available in sturdy Ballistic Nylon, Neoprene, or custom-fit leatherette.
- Replacement Foam and Springs: Over time, driver-side seat foam collapses. Changing the cushion restores appropriate assistance and posture.
- Upholstery Kits: Full leather or cloth replacement kits allow owners to swap out stained or torn factory fabric for a new factory-style finish.
2. Floor Protection
Mud, snow, and spilled coffee are opponents of factory carpeting. High-quality floor covering parts secure the structural metal below.
- All-Weather Floor Mats: Custom-molded thermoplastic rubber mats trap liquids, dirt, and particles, avoiding them from seeping into the carpet.
- Vinyl Flooring Kits: Popular amongst work truck owners, vinyl flooring changes the carpet totally, making washdowns remarkably simple.
3. Control Panel and Center Console
The dashboard is the visual centerpiece of the truck. Sun exposure frequently causes warping, fading, and breaking.
- Dash Covers: Carpet or molded plastic dash mats protect against UV rays and cover existing fractures.
- Center Console Lids and Armrests: The factory vinyl armrest often cracks under the weight of elbows. Replacements come in updated memory foam covered in resilient leather or durable fabric.
- Trim Kits: Wood grain, carbon fiber, and brushed aluminum overlay sets allow drivers to quickly tailor the look of their center stack and door panels.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I install Dodge Ram interior parts myself, or do I require a professional?
Numerous interior parts-- such as floor mats, seat covers, dash mats, and center console organizers-- are developed for simple, tool-free DIY setup. However, more complex tasks like changing a headliner, swapping out a control panel assembly, or rewiring electrical components might require professional support or specialized tools.
Are aftermarket interior parts as good as OEM parts?
It depends upon the brand and the part.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) parts guarantee a specific color match and accurate fit. However, numerous reputable aftermarket brand names actually surpass factory designs-- such as utilizing thicker plastics for console latches or more long lasting stitching for seat covers.
How do I discover the specific part that fits my particular Ram trim level?
Due to the fact that Dodge provides numerous cab sizes (Regular Cab, Quad Cab, Crew Cab, Mega Cab) and trim levels (Tradesman, Laramie, Limited, TRX), interior measurements can vary significantly. Constantly validate your truck's year, model, taxi size, and VIN before purchasing replacement interior parts, especially for items like floor mats and seat upholstery.
